Iowa Constitution
Article V - JUDICIAL DEPARTMENT.
§ 14 System of court practice.

It shall be the duty of the general assembly to provide for the carrying into effect of this article, and to provide for a general system of practice in all the courts of this state.

For provisions relative to the grand jury, see this codified Iowa Constitution, Art. I, §11

Statutory provisions relating to the organization and administration of the judicial branch, see Iowa Code chapter 602
